About The Position

Responsible for the efficient operations of the surveillance department during assigned shift. Protect company assets by observing gaming and non-gaming activities to ensure safety, integrity, security and company policies and procedures are followed. Observe gaming and non-gaming activity by monitoring electronic surveillance equipment to ensure compliance with applicable laws, procedures, regulations and rules and protect company assets from illegal or questionable activities. Detect cheating, theft, embezzlement, illegal activities and procedure/policy violations in all areas of responsibility. Prepare reports and/or verbalize the occurrence of unusual activities to the Surveillance Manager, Director and/or department heads as required. Compile and maintain evidence to assist the property or BGC in any legal actions, employment matters and/or arbitration/grievance proceedings that may arise. Know how to operate all equipment used by the Surveillance Department and utilize them to their fullest capacity. Review coverage completed by agents and have additional coverage added when needed. Assign task to agents to agents on a daily basis when needed. Train, coach, discipline, supervise and handle scheduling of department employees. Miscellaneous du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• Must be at least 21 years of age.
  • Three (3) years of practical surveillance experience.
  • Previous supervisory experience preferred.
  • Thorough knowledge of all table games rules, procedures, and gaming regulations.
  • Working knowledge of surveillance software and Microsoft Office programs.
  • Knowledge of surveillance equipment.
  • Knowledge of state regulations, departmental procedures, and company policies.
  • Effective communication skills.
  • Ability to maintain order in escalated situations.
  • Ability to sit and remain alert for extended periods.
  • Ability to obtain/maintain necessary licenses and certifications.
